How Our Tile Floor Water Damage Restoration Service Works
When you call us for tile floor water damage restoration, our team springs into action. We’ll arrive within 60 minutes, equipped to handle the job. Our rapid assessment ensures we identify the source of the damage and create a plan to restore your floors to their original condition.
Step 1: Emergency Response
We’ll extract water from your property using our industrial-strength pumps and mitigate any safety risks.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ring your family’s health.
Step 2: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ll set up industrial dehumidifiers and air blowers to dry your floors and walls. This process typically takes 3-5 days, depending on the severity of the damage.
Step 3: Cleaning and Disinfecting
We’ll thoroughly clean and disinfect your floors and surrounding areas to prevent mold growth and bacterial contamination.
Step 4: Repair and Replacement
Our team will assess the damage and make any necessary repairs or replacements to your tile floors and surrounding materials.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Follow-up
We’ll conduct a final inspection to ensure your floors are safe, functional, and healthy. We’ll also follow up with you to ensure you’re satisfied with the work.

Tile Floor Water Damage Restoration Cost in SeaTac, WA
Prices for tile floor water damage restoration vary based on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Get a free estimate to find out the costs involved.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Response and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age and size of affected area |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area and duration of drying process |
| Cleaning and Disinfecting |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area and level of contamination |
| Repair and Replacement | $1,000 – $10,000 | Severity of damage and type of materials affected |
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. Get a free estimate to find out the costs involved in your tile floor water damage restoration project.
